Ask a Question

SwaggerHub Pause Integrations Option

SwaggerHub Pause Integrations Option

When working on an API in SwaggerHub with multiple integrations, every time I update the API, each integration kicks in (pushing multiple commits to GitHub, updating AWS, etc). 

 

In order to iteratively work on my API in small steps, I need to disable each integration one-by-one, and then re-enable them one-by-one when I get my API where I want it to be.

 

It would be useful to have a fast (one-click) way to disable and then re-enable all integrations so that I can work on my API without thrashing my integration targets.

4 Comments
fbmattos
SmartBear Alumni (Retired)

Hi barak-

 

Really sorry about the delay getting back. We're in the process of planning our revamped editor UX, and we can add a button next to the integrations that quickly allows you to enable/disable integrations.

 

Another option we're looking into is to allow you to work on drafts, and then 'commit' you changes when you're ready. The integrations in this case would trigger on the commit only, and I believe it would solve your problem as well, agreed?

 

Regards,
Fernando

Nohcs777
Regular Visitor

I like the commit changes idea!


@barak wrote:

When working on an API in SwaggerHub with multiple integrations, every time I update the API, each integration kicks in (pushing multiple commits to GitHub, updating AWS, etc). 

 

In order to iteratively work on my API in small steps, I need to disable each integration one-by-one, and then re-enable them one-by-one when I get my API where I want it to be.

 

It would be useful to have a fast (one-click) way to disable and then re-enable all integrations so that I can work on my API without thrashing my integration targets.


 

TanyaYatskovska
SmartBear Alumni (Retired)
Status changed to: New Idea
 
HKosova
SmartBear Alumni (Retired)

Update: Source control integrations are now decoupled from the "Save" action. There's a separate "Push" button to push the changes to the connected repository.

 

push-to-source-control.gif

 

API gateway integrations and webhooks are still triggered on save.

 
Announcements
Welcome to the SwaggerHub Feature Requests board!

Here you can review already submitted feature requests and vote up the ones you like! If you can't find the feature you want - go ahead and suggest your own idea. Ideas with the highest rating can be implemented in the product.

Check out the Create a Feature Request guide for more information.
New Here?
Welcome to the Community
Sign Up Here